Hard body fishing lures are essential tools for anglers across the USA, offering unmatched durability and realistic swimming actions that trigger aggressive strikes from predatory fish. Falling under the broader category of fishing lures and baits, these solid plastic or wood creations include crankbaits, jerkbaits, poppers, and swimbaits. American consumers gravitate toward hard body lures because they can withstand the punishing teeth of species like bass, pike, and muskie while providing precise depth control and acoustic attraction through internal rattles. The appeal lies in their versatility and longevity; unlike soft plastics that tear after a single catch, a high quality hard lure is an investment that performs consistently in both freshwater lakes and coastal saltwater environments, making it a staple in every serious tackle box.

How to Choose the Right Hard Body Lure

The true difference between a mediocre hard lure and a great one comes down to its buoyancy profile and the quality of its hardware. You must evaluate whether the lure suspends, floats, or sinks at the exact depth where your target species is feeding, while ensuring the split rings and treble hooks can handle sudden, violent tension without bending.

Match the dive bill size and angle to your target depth; a long, horizontal bill dives deep, while a short, vertical bill stays shallow.

Ignore flashy holographic paint jobs if the lure lacks internal weight transfer systems, which are crucial for long, accurate casts in windy conditions.

Check the hook quality out of the box; premium lures feature chemically sharpened, saltwater grade treble hooks, whereas cheap lures often require immediate hook replacement.

Identify your water clarity; choose silent, natural colored lures for clear water and loud, rattling lures in bright colors for stained or muddy environments.
